Competing in a Crowded Market
As Starbucks faces stiff competition from emerging beverage chains like Dutch Bros and Black Rock Coffee, adjusting its menu to appeal to modern consumers is more crucial than ever. The new afternoon offerings not only target the increasing health consciousness seen in 40% of food and beverage sales but also challenge the rapid growth of these competitors. Industry insights suggest that by emphasizing clean ingredients and reduced sugar options, Starbucks is poised to capture a larger share of the afternoon crowd.
Health-Conscious Choices Drive Innovation
The heart of the new afternoon menu lies in its health-forward options. The revamped Refreshers line, which utilizes caffeine sourced from green coffee extract, serves as a cleaner alternative to traditional energy drinks. Coupled with delicious matcha-based beverages and adjustable sweetness chai lattes, this new lineup is designed to attract health-aware consumers seeking flavorful yet nutritious alternatives. Customers can enjoy beverages that are not only refreshing but also align with their wellness goals.
A Broader Food Strategy
Not just content with reshaping its drink reviews, Starbucks also plans to enhance its food offerings, introducing more protein- and fiber-rich snacks that are easy to grab on the go. The focus on catering to both morning and afternoon patrons reaffirms the importance of food in the company's overall strategy, representing nearly $6 billion in annual sales. Items like portable flatbreads and pizza-style snacks reflect the trend toward convenient eating without sacrificing quality or health.
